New team members: read this before any emergency. The pagination layer of the Lanternfell REST API keeps cursor state in a dedicated token store. Under normal operations you never touch it directly — cursors are opaque and self-expiring. During a break-glass event (e.g., corrupted cursor index causing infinite page loops), two engineers must approve access, and all actions are logged to the Wrenhall audit stream. Opening the sealed token store during such an event requires the recovery passphrase.

unlock words, tawif-tahop: oliys-ulawyn-tamdor-lamys-casox-jormir-fraius-kasath-ulador-ulamir-holir-sorys-holeth

Handover note — Crumbwheel order cutoffs.

Welcome aboard. The bakery cutoff rule in Crumbwheel closes same-day orders at 14:00 local to each storefront, not UTC — this has bitten us twice. Holiday overrides live in the calendar service and take precedence silently, so always check there first when a cutoff looks wrong. To unlock the calendar service's admin console after a restart, enter the recovery passphrase below.

vault phrase of bagap-bahaf = silion-pelox-sorox-casdor-quenwyn-fraax-eliox-praael-kelion-quenvan-kasox-rusael-norius-belvan

Subject: Relevance tuning changes landing in Skimmerlane 7.3

Hello plugin authors,

The 7.3 release adjusts phrase-match weighting and deprecates the legacy `boost_map` hook. Plugins that score documents directly should migrate to the new `rescore_hook` before the cutover on the Arbordale staging ring. Regression suites ran clean on our side. For verification, reference the build token shown below.

pipeline stamp: htk3_cc5

Capacity note for the Fennelgrid sidecar review. Aggregation window widened to cut emit rate; per-pod memory ceiling holds at current cardinality (~12k series). CPU flat. Risk: buffer overflow if a tenant spikes labels — mitigated by the drop policy. No node-pool changes needed for the Caldermoor cluster this quarter. Review the flush and buffer settings before merge. Constants under review are below.

limits module of yafop-hahag:
QUOTAS = {
    "tamwyn": 652,
    "prawyn": 731,
}